Tax Software Issues Spur Watchdog Group

Jeffrey Rosenthal, Tax Preparers Watch GroupTaxWorks users who banded together to deal with disasters with that software package have reformed to deal with issues facing professional tax preparers. Called Tax Preparers Watch Group, the organization is seeking to enlist anyone interested in dealing with software and governmental issues, indeed, any issues common to the tax preparation profession.

 

"We intend to be inclusive," says Jeffery Rosenthal of Villa Rose Associates, based in Marlboro, N.J., and Brooklyn, N.Y.

The members that formed the group had bonded together through social media when faced with severe problems of the TaxWorks software during Tax Season. The software, owned by a subsidiary of H&R Block, was sold to Thomson Reuters at the end of tax season.

Rosenthal says members want to address common issues and also to negotiate group pricing for products they use. He also wants it to evaluate major and minor vendors in areas such as functionality and price and "what the software will not do."
